* Bertelsmann AG is the immediate parent of Bertelsmann Asia Investments AG (“BAI”) which is an investment vehicle used to finance Bertelsmann’s strategic investments. Foundations (Bertelsmann Stiftung, Reinhard Mohn Stiftung, BVG-Stiftung) indirectly hold 80.9 percent of Bertelsmann AG’s shares, with the remaining 19.1 percent held indirectly by the Mohn family. Bertelsmann Verwaltungsgesellschaft (BVG) controls all voting rights at the Bertelsmann AG Annual General Meeting.

Item 1. Security and Issuer.

This statement on Schedule 13D (this “Statement”) supplements the statement on Schedule 13G filed on November 13, 2008 (as amended by Amendment No. 1 filed on December 3, 2008) which relates to the ordinary share, par value $0.0001 per share (the "Share") of China Distance Education Holdings Limited, a Cayman Islands corporation (the "Issuer"). The Issuer's principal executive offices are located at 18th Floor, Xueyuan International Tower, 1 Zhichun Road, Haidian District, Beijing, 100083, People's Republic of China.

Item 2. Identity and Background.

(a) This Statement is being filed by the following reporting persons: Bertelsmann AG, a German corporation, and Bertelsmann Asia Investments AG (“BAI”), a Switzerland company (collectively, the "Reporting Persons").

(b) The address of the principal business office of Bertelsmann AG is Carl-Bertelsmann-Strasse 270, D-33311 Gütersloh, Germany. The address of the principal business office of BAI is Dammstrasse 19, CH-6300 Zug, Switzerland.

(c) and (f) The jurisdiction of incorporation for Bertelsmann AG is Federal Republic of Germany. The jurisdiction of incorporation for BAI is Switzerland.

Item 3. Source and Amount of Funds or Other Consideration.

In May 2008, BAI acquired 5,243,650 ordinary shares of the Issuer from Champion Shine Trading Limited (“Champion Shine”) at a per share price of $2.995966 for an aggregate purchase price of $15,709,797 pursuant to a Share Purchase Agreement dated May 7, 2008 by and among by and among Champion Shine Trading Limited, Bertelsmann Asia Investments AG and Zhu Zhengdong.

In July 2008, BAI acquired an aggregate of 1,750,000 ordinary shares as represented by 437,500 ADSs from the open market.

The above purchases were funded from BAI’s working capital.

In November 2008, pursuant to a Settlement Agreement dated October 16, 2008, Champion Shine transferred an additional 9,274,873 ordinary shares to BAI in settlement of all of the claims, obligations and liabilities under the May 7, 2008 Share Purchase Agreement.

Item 4. Purpose of Transaction.

The information set forth in Item 3 is hereby incorporated by reference in this Item 4.

On November 18, 2008, Annabelle Yu Long, managing director of BAI, became a director of the Issuer. The Reporting Persons previously filed a statement on Schedule 13G to report the acquisition that is the subject of this Schedule 13D, and is filing this schedule because of Rule 13d-1(e) promulgated under the Act.
